			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<h1>H-E-B to open in-store credit union branches</h1>
<p>The Texas grocery store has announced that five Generations Federal Credit Union branches will open in Bexar County stores. </p>
<p>This will offer more resources to credit union members living around the area and will provide convenient, in-and-out transactions for credit union shoppers. </p>
<p>San Antonio Business Journal reports almost 50,000 members in Generations Federal Credit Union San Antonio network, making it the fifth largest credit union in the region. </p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<h1>Lower APR rates for credit union members</h1>
<p>The start of February 2012 marks lower rates for credit card holders with the annual percentage falling to 14.91 percent.  Reports say this rate is the lowest it has been since August 2011 and should continue to decrease. </p>
<p>With only one month gone in 2012, the rate has dropped from 15.14 percent to 14.91.  This is promising news for customers who should expect to see a change in the average APR they’re used to.  </p>
<p>Pentagon Federal Credit Union reported a 4-point APR decrease on Visa Platinum Cash Rewards, reported creditcards.com. </p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<h2>VFCU &amp; Los Fresnos High School working together</h2>
<p>The first student-run branch of Valley Federal Credit Union is located at Los Fresnos High School. This project was started by Valley Federal Credit Union in 2004 as a way to give back to the community and help educate our youth.<br />
The branch at Los Fresnos High School functions as a complete working branch of Valley Federal Credit Union, except with two main differences:</p>
<ul>
<li>It is open only to students and staff</li>
</ul>
<p>The VFCU branch shows students first hand about the importance of efficient financial practices and transactions. The first two students who helped start the Los Fresnos VFCU branch are now full-time tellers at our main branch in Brownsville. Valley Federal Credit Union encourages graduating student tellers to assume full-time positions at our main branch, as well. We also highly encourage other students, faculty and staff members to open accounts and practice taking care of their financial needs.</p>
<p>The “Falcon Branch” is an operating branch of Valley Federal Credit Union. It is open to students, faculty, and staff. The Falcon Branch shows students firsthand about the importance of responsible financial practices. We are now approaching our 8th school year; we encourage our teller-students, and are proud to have added on the students’ employed there to continue on with VFCU. We have been very fortunate to have students transfer to other depts. As well as further their education. Our staff along, with the student- tellers have given classroom presentations and encourage students and faculty to open accts. with VFCU.</p>

<h2>Stock Market Game</h2>
<p>Certain Brownsville schools participate in the Stock Market Game, a program which helps students get involved and learn about the buying and selling of commodities (stock). Throughout the fiscal year, students buy and sell certain stocks in hopes of making successful trades. At the end of the year, Valley Federal Credit Union hosts an Award Brunch at our main office in Brownsville recognizing the students’ success by awarding trophies and certificates.</p>
